Is Elk Grove expensive to live?
Elk Grove’s housing expenses are 78% higher than the national average and the utility prices are 8% higher than the national average. Transportation expenses like bus fares and gas prices are 32% higher than the national average. Elk Grove has grocery prices that are 4% higher than the national average.

Are people moving to Elk Grove?
People of Elk Grove – Population & Demographics
During the span of ten years between 2000 to 2010, nearly 100,000 relocated to Elk Grove, a jump of over 155%. While growth has slowed over the past few years, the current population is now 166,228 residents with a median age of 36 years old.

Is Roseville better than Elk Grove?
Elk Grove, CA has a crime index 67 below the national average, while Roseville, CA has a crime index that is 89 below the national average. The homeownership rate in Elk Grove, CA is 74%, which is 13% above the national average. The homeownership rate in Roseville, CA is 68%, which is 5% above the national average.

What is the richest part of Elk Grove?
As you can see, Elk Grove’s wealthiest areas are on its outer edges: Sheldon to the east and Laguna West near the southwest corner of the city. The lower-income areas are near Highway 99: west of the freeway and north of Laguna Boulevard, and east of the freeway and south of Bond Road.

What is coming to Elk Grove CA?
Construction is happening now on the $500 million dollar Sky River Casino on the south side of town. The facilities will include a 110,260 square-foot gaming floor, 2,000 slot machines, and a 12-story hotel with more than 300 guest rooms. The casino is expected to open in 2022.
